Here's a weird #drumming fascination for the day -- #thursdeath drummers who effortlessly switch from 16th to 32nd notes on the bass drums.
Something I could never do when I was still drumming, but it sounds epic. I mostly played singles and couldn't master heel-toe before moving onto other pursuits.
IOTUNN's 'Kinship Elegiac' is a good example of that.
*Hoarder victory dance!* I bought this curved cymbal stand arm several years ago, honestly not having a particular need for it, but enticed by the novelty, and it was on closeout—presumably not a big seller. Today I was trying to figure out how to mount a crash on the far side of my rack tom without adding a whole new stand, and a memory lightbulb lit up! It’s perfect.

I’ve really enjoyed working with @ology on his toolkit for scoring #MIDI #drumming, MIDI-Drummer-Tiny. He’s patiently answered my questions and had the grace to accept my pull requests, most of which haven’t so much added new features as they’ve helped clarify how to use the library successfully.
Gene has helped me get back into the swing of #Perl #programming after months of inactivity, and I’m looking forward to working with him more in the future. I couldn’t have asked for a better collaborator.
